"""
Regression guard: a normal (non-transcription) session with no guardrails must
keep triggering response.create on a completed transcription event.
Regression guard: without realtime_input_transcription guardrails, the proxy
must not inject response.create on transcription completion because the
backend's own server-VAD auto-response is still responsible for the turn.
"""
